Inspect, extract, and apply RTPatch .rtp binary patch files.
Licensed under MIT. The RTPatch format is undocumented. The binary layout, codec, and opcode semantics were reverse-engineered with Claude (Anthropic). See SPEC.md for the full format description.

rtptool apply <file.rtp> --source <dir> --output <dir> [options]
Reads source files from --source, writes patched versions to --output. Source subdirectory structure is preserved.
$ rtptool apply update.rtp --source ./v1.0 --output ./v1.1
Applying 12 MODIFY patch(es):
source : ./v1.0
output : ./v1.1
[OK] engine.dll 446549 B -> 446549 B (./v1.1/engine.dll)
[OK] game.exe 8500623 B -> 9447947 B (./v1.1/game.exe)
[SKIP] driver.dll -- source not found: ./v1.0/driver.dll
[SKIP] loader.dll -- checksum mismatch (...); use --no-checksum to apply anyway
Done: 10 patched, 2 skipped, 0 errors

| Message | Meaning |
|---|---|
source not found: ./v1.0/foo.dll |
Source file missing from --source directory |
checksum mismatch (expected 0x…, got 0x…) |
Source file checksum doesn't match — wrong version; pass --no-checksum to apply anyway |
bad diff magic: 0x… (want 0xB59C) |
Corrupt or truncated patch file |
unknown opcode 0x… at stream offset … |
Decompressed diff is corrupt |

// Parse a .rtp file
pub fn parse(data: Vec<u8>) -> Result<RtpPatch, RtpError>;
// Decompress and apply one MODIFY record
pub fn patch_file(
patch: &RtpPatch,
record: &FileRecord,
src_data: &[u8],
check_sum: bool,
) -> Result<Vec<u8>, RtpError>;
// 31-bit rolling checksum (w1 field in entry descriptors)
pub fn checksum_w1(data: &[u8]) -> u32;
// 30-bit rolling checksum (w2 field, used for source validation)
pub fn checksum_w2(data: &[u8]) -> u32;
